Lead Software Engineer
Pittsburgh, Vereinigte StaatenJob Details
- Gehalt:$180,000.00
- Branche:Software Entwicklung
- Type: Festanstellung
Position Overview
Senior Software Engineer (Microsoft development stack)
Full-time, direct hire
100% remote
Financial Services
My client, a Fortune 500 Financial Services organization, is adding two additional Senior Software Engineers to their Engineering team. The ideal candidate would be someone who has been a Software Engineer for several years and who has experience leading projects in an enterprise technology environment. This person will also be responsible for working with and developing junior engineers, supporting them with understanding business requirements and removing any blockers in the SDLC.
Required Experience
- 5+ years experience in software or applications engineering in an enterprise environment
- Extensive experience working with the Microsoft development stack
- Experience building applications using C# & .NET (ideally 2+ years experience with .NET 6+)
- Real-world experience writing ASP.NET Core Web API services
- Demonstrable knowledge regarding unit test suites such as NUnit, XUnit, Moq
- Experience working with Azure cloud technologies including Azure DevOps
- Relational database experience with an emphasis on SQL Server 2018+
- Familiarity with Angular, JSON, XML, REST
- A good understanding of security best practices
- Effective in fast paced environment
- Proactively report status to stakeholders
- Exceptional organizational skills
- Excellent communication skills, both written & verbal